Infrastructure is a huge investment at Canva, consisting of Cloud Platforms, Developer Platforms, and Reliability Platforms that are used by all Canva engineers, and therefore crucial to the scaling of the organisation. As such, we’re looking to gain a better, data-driven understanding of how our users interact with our products.
Analytics Engineers in Infra apply software engineering best practices on a daily basis to create, maintain and operate data platforms that deliver data sets, from which we derive insights to ultimately improve the Infrastructure product offerings, thereby improving the efficiency and experience of all Canva engineers.
